1 #ifndef PhysicsTools_MVATrainer_MVATrainer_h
2 #define PhysicsTools_MVATrainer_MVATrainer_h
8 #include <xercesc/dom/DOM.hpp>
22 namespace PhysicsTools {
30 const char *styleSheet = 0);
50 const std::string &ext,
51 const std::string &
arg =
"")
const;
71 processor(processor), calib(calib) {}
87 const std::vector<CalibratedProcessor> &procs,
88 bool withTarget)
const;
96 std::vector<AtomicId> &train)
const;
107 std::auto_ptr<XMLDocument>
xml;
120 #endif // PhysicsTools_MVATrainer_MVATrainer_h
TrainProcessor *const proc
static void cleanup(const Factory::MakerMap::value_type &v)
std::vector< Variable::Flags > flags
#define XERCES_CPP_NAMESPACE_QUALIFIER
MVATrainerComputer * calib